Since most of the ICOs are residing on ERC20 etherium platform, due to bear market conditions, some are cautious about going live or conducting token sales.
I have seen many projects which are waiting for good market conditions. Off course some projects are continuously focusing on development part with the funding from private sales. Only those which have strong foundation, good experienced professional team and advisers are confident about their success.
Also soon the most awaiting decisions about ETF and regulation on cryptocurrency, will decide the fate of some projects.
Lets hope that year 2019 will bring the hopes which were there in mid 2017 or early 2018.
